Simple question (I think!.

Can I create a flip-book and install within a Joomla article? I don't want to create the flip-book FROM existing Joomla articles, just place lots of flip-books inside lots of articles without needing menu entries for each. Many thanks...

Hello,

Currently the extension can create a book based on Joomla! articles. We will add ability to specify book pages directly in plugin code in the next version of the extension.
